
The Waitakere Family Start is a support service which helps parents meet basic needs, working with families from pregnancy through to their child’s first three years of life.
This includes families in poor living situations and women leaving family violence situations.
Family Start team leader Rebecca Gross says many of the service’s families have limited family support and find it helpful to have a listening ear.
“They also like that we’re a home-visiting service which makes life simpler,” she says.
Its service offers counselling and budgeting services, parenting programmes and legal advice around issues such as protection orders.
Qualified social workers also offer parenting support and assistance with accessing daycare to ensure parents get some time out from their children.
The service is available to families in Warkworth and Wellsford.
All parents or caregivers need is a referral from their doctor or hospital, midwife, Plunket nurse, Well Child provider or other agency like Maternity Mental Health or Oranga Tamariki.
